Aston Martin DB4

Work on the Aston Martin DB4 began in 1956, at the same time as the Aston Martin DB Mark III. Those in charge of the development of the DB4, General Manager John Wyer, chassis designer Harold Beach, and engine designer Tadek Marek, had the goal of creating an entirely new car. Carrozzeria Touring of Milan employed the 'Superleggera' system, attaching lightweight alloy panels to a tubular chassis atop a robust platform, to design the four-seater body. The DB4 was unveiled at the London Motor Show in 1958, located on the same showroom floor as the DB Mark III, which stayed in production until shortly after the car's debut. Its powerful engine and sophisticated design earned the DB4 the title of the world's first production car capable of reaching 0–100–0 mph in less than thirty seconds. With its impressive performance, the Aston Martin DB4 established the brand as a serious competitor amidst other Mediterranean sports car manufacturers. Tadek Marek's new 3.7 litre, six-cylinder twin overhead camshaft, all alloy engine first ran in 1956 and was raced in the Aston Martin DBR2 in 1957. Afterwards, a four-seater convertible was revealed at the London Motor Show in 1961. By the conclusion of its production run in 1963, the DB4 had five distinct series, such as the Aston Martin DB4 GT and Aston Martin DB4 GT Zagato. Technical Specifications
  • Engine: all dohc I-6, 3670 cc, 240 bhp @ 5500 rpm, 240 lbs-ft @4250 rpm; Vantage: 266 bhp @5750 rpm
  • Transmission: 4-speed manual with optional overdrive or optional Borg-Warner 3-speed automatic
  • Suspension: Front: upper-and-lower A-arms, coil springs, anti-roll bar Rear: live axle, Watt linkage, trailing links, coil springs
  • Brakes: Servo assisted front/rear discs
  • Length: 14'9"
  • Width: 5'6"
  • Height: 4'4"
  • Wheelbase: 8'4"
  • Weight: 1308kg
  • Top Speed: 140 mph
  • 0-60 mph: 9 sec.
  • Price New: £ 3,976 (Saloon), £ 4,194 (Convertible)
  • Production Dates: October 1958 - June 1963
